Structured_descriptionAutomated_descriptionEnriched in RIB; excretory system; head mesodermal cell; and intestine based on RNA-seq; single-cell RNA-seq; and microarray studies. Is affected by several genes including daf-16; daf-2; and skn-1 based on microarray; tiling array; and RNA-seq studies. Is affected by twenty-two chemicals including tryptophan; methylmercury hydroxide; and bisphenol A based on microarray and RNA-seq studies. Is predicted to encode a protein with the following domains: MATH/TRAF domain; MATH domain; TRAF-like; and SKP1/BTB/POZ domain superfamily.Paper_evidenceWBPaper00065943
